nasai-kubra:6810al-Ḥusayn b. Ḥurayth > al-Faḍl b. Mūsá > al-Ḥusayn b. Wāqid > Thābit > ʿAbdullāh b. ʿUmar

[Machine] "The Messenger of Allah prohibited the consumption of intoxicating drinks." Said Abu 'Abd al-Rahman, and this hadith has been narrated from Ibn 'Umar from 'Umar from the Prophet, ﷺ , with a slightly different wording."  

الكبرى للنسائي:٦٨١٠أَخْبَرَنَا الْحُسَيْنُ بْنُ حُرَيْثٍ قَالَ أَخْبَرَنَا الْفَضْلُ بْنُ مُوسَى عَنِ الْحُسَيْنِ بْنِ وَاقِدٍ عَنْ ثَابِتٍ عَنْ عَبْدِ اللهِ بْنِ عُمَرَ قَالَ

«نَهَى رَسُولُ اللهِ ﷺ عَنْ نَبِيذِ الْجَرِّ» قَالَ أَبُو ع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 وَقَدْ رُوِيَ هَذَا الْحَدِيثُ عَنِ ابْنِ عُمَرَ عَنْ عُمَرَ عَنِ النَّبِيِّ ﷺ بِغَيْرِ هَذَا اللَّفْظِ
